Actinobacterial Species Selection for Production of Antimicrobial Peptide using PROMETHEE GAIA

Author(s): Palanisamy Priya Dharsini* and Palanisamy Selvamani
Abstract: The investigation of robust antimicrobial peptides from the natural environment has promptly been boosting strength with the upsurge in multi-drug resistant pathogens. Actinobacteria are assorted cluster of Gram positive, high GC content and filamentous bacteria and considered as an admirable elaborators of therapeutic products. In the present study, antibacterial potential of crude peptides has been evaluated by initial screening of thirteen actinobacterial isolates. Isolate PPD 6 is the most promising candidate for the antimicrobial peptide production based on decision vector through key physical and chemical parameters as temperature, pH (Buffers) and antibiotic resistance as a competent of multi-criteria decision analyses (MCDA) and ranking with Preference Ranking Organisation Method for Enrichment Evaluation (PROMETHEE) and Graphical Analysis for Interactive Assistance (GAIA) analysis. Biological activity was analysed in the presence of enzymes, chemicals, solvents and metals, no loss in their activity were recorded.
